PROJECTED LINEUPS (Subject to change)

FLYERS

28 Claude Giroux - 13 Kevin Hayes - 93 Jakub Voracek
23 Oskar Lindblom -14 Sean Couturier - 11 Travis Konecny
25 James van Riemsdyk - Scott Laughton - 81 Carsen Twarynski
12 Michael Raffl - 82 Connor Bunnaman - 18 Tyler Pitlick

9 Ivan Provorov - 61 Justin Braun
6 Travis Sanheim - 15 Matt Niskanen
8 Robert Hägg - 53 Shayne Gostisbehere

79 Carter Hart
[37 Brian Elliott]

PP1: Giroux, Couturier, JVR, Voracek, Gostisbehere.
PP2: JVR, Hayes, Lindblom, Provorov, Niskanen.

Scratch: 5 Sam Morin (healthy)
Injured non-roster: 19 Nolan Patrick (migraines), 3 Andy Welinski (lower body).

BLACKHAWKS

92 Alexander Nylander - 19 Jonathan Toews - 88 Patrick Kane
12 Alex DeBrincat - 17 Dylan Strome - 65 Andrew Shaw
20 Brandon Saad - 64 David Kampf - 8 Dominik Kubalik
15 Zack Smith - 22 Ryan Carpenter - 91 Drake Caggiula

2 Duncan Keith - 56 Erik Gustafsson
6 Olli Määttä - 7 Brent Seabrook 
68 Slater Koekkoek - [39 Dennis Gilbert]

50 Corey Crawford
[40 Robin Lehner]

Scratches: 11 Brendan Perlini (healthy), 44 Calvin de Haan (groin).
Injured reserve: 5 Connor Murphy (groin), 47 John Quenneville (hip).
Injured non-roster: 77 Kirby Dach (concussion).
